Exploring the Ancient Meaning and Vibrant Spirituality of Australian Aboriginal Art

Art, in its many forms, is a bold expression of human creativity. It can connect us to the past, reflect the present, and envision the future. One such art form known for its rich cultural significance and aesthetic allure is Australian Aboriginal Art. With roots dating back at least 65,000 years, it is one of the world's oldest art traditions that still flourishes today.

A Canvas of Stories

Australian Aboriginal Art is a profound visual diary that encapsulates the history, belief systems, and social structures of the Aboriginal people. From the spiritual sagas of the Dreamtime (an era that accounts for the creation of the world and all of its beings), to the depictions of daily Aboriginal life - every symbol, colour and pattern in Aboriginal Art narrates a compelling story.

The Vibrancy of Dot Painting

Perhaps the best-known technique in Aboriginal art is dot painting - a style that uses tiny dots to form symbols and figures on canvas, bark, or body. Originating from the desire to keep certain stories and traditions secret from outsiders, dot painting evolved as a form of encrypted communication. The position, colour and size of the dots conceal a multitude of meanings beneath an arresting array of patterns and hues.

Spirituality and Ancestral Connections

The central theme of Aboriginal Art revolves around the Aboriginal Dreamtime - the mythological period of creation that holds great spiritual significance for Indigenous Australians. With symbols depicting ancestral spirits, sacred landscapes, and animal totems, this art radiates a profound spiritual connection to the land and fosters a deep understanding of Aboriginal beliefs.

Channeling Traditions into Contemporary Art

While respecting their ancient roots, Aboriginal artists are also pushing the boundaries of tradition to explore contemporary interpretations. These modern adaptations trailblaze new paths of creativity, while always maintaining the heart of Aboriginal storytelling and spirituality at their core.
